Ingredients
- 1/2 cup of rich butter
- A delightful 1/2 cup of golden brown sugar
- Two lovely eggs
- 1/2 cup of pure unsweetened applesauce
- A touch of aromatic 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 2 cups of hearty large flake oats
- 1 1/2 cups of wholesome whole wheat flour
- A teaspoon of leavening baking powder
- A pinch of salt, a teaspoonful
- A dash of fragrant ground cinnamon, a teaspoon
- 1/2 teaspoon of baking soda for lightness
- A generous cup of plump raisins
- A 1/2 cup of unsweetened shredded coconut
- 1/2 cup of crunchy sunflower seeds
- A 1/2 cup of nutritious pumpkin seeds
- A 1/4 cup of tiny sesame seeds
- A 1/4 cup of finely ground flax seeds
Step 1
Begin by preheating your oven to a cozy 350 degrees Fahrenheit (175 degrees Celsius) and prepare three baking sheets by lining them with parchment paper for easy cleanup later on.
Step 2
In a mixing bowl, let the magic unfold as you whip together the butter and brown sugar until they transform into a velvety, creamy mixture, using the power of an electric mixer. Now, it's time to introduce the eggs into this delightful concoction and mix them in thoroughly. To enhance the flavors, stir in the applesauce and a splash of vanilla extract, blending until everything is harmoniously combined.
Step 3
In a separate bowl, create a symphony of flavors by mixing together oats, whole wheat flour, baking powder, a pinch of salt, and a hint of cinnamon. Slowly unite this flour mixture with the buttery concoction, stirring until a perfect marriage is formed. To add some texture and nuttiness, gently fold in a medley of raisins, coconut flakes, sunflower seeds, pumpkin seeds, sesame seeds, and a sprinkle of ground flaxseed.
Step 4
Now, onto the exciting part - shaping the cookies! Grab a rounded tablespoon of the dough and place it on the prepared baking sheets, gently pressing down with a fork that's been dipped in cold water to create a lovely pattern.
Step 5
Pop these delectable treats into the preheated oven and let them bake until they turn a glorious golden hue and are perfectly set, which should take around 11 to 13 minutes. Enjoy the delightful aroma wafting through your kitchen as you patiently wait for these scrumptious cookies to be ready to devour.
